The new Dashilar Dashilar is an important stop on the south side of Beijing’s Central Axis. For hundreds of years, it has been an important center of business, entertainment and culture. An attempt to revitalize it has been underway since 2010. However, the developers still have a lot of work ahead of them if they want to win the neighborhood’s trust and access to improve the homes.
